How to Go Lean with SAFe DevOps

The Scaled Agile Framework can integrate seamlessly with DevOps when done correctly. Unfortunately, since both ideologies are more of a culture shift and not necessarily a set checklist, it can be challenging to implement. You can’t just check off the boxes and say you’re using DevOps and agile. They both require full buy-in from all users, including management and employees alike.

At the foundation of both frameworks is the concept of inter-departmental collaboration. The software development team cannot work in a separate silo from the organizational operations department; they need to work together.

Encourage regular communications and meetings between both departments. This is where scrum meetings in the agile framework can be very beneficial. In essence, the people using the code need to be working together with the people writing the code.

Putting These Ideas Into Action

So, how can you put that into action in your everyday work environment? One of the key processes embedded in the DevOps foundation is to automate as much as you can. When you start to scale and create new products at a rapid pace, you need to automate.

Whether you’re building new systems, eliminating redundancies or running tests, find or create ways to automate as much as you can. It will enable you to truly increase your productivity and launch more new products.

And just as in agile, with DevOps, you need to be able to test fast, fail fast, then pivot and change quickly to adapt. You need to know what the market wants and what the customers expect. Then you need to be able to react quickly to provide them with the products that fit those desires and expectations.
